In mid-2014 Edlund – who created the comic book, animated and live action “Tick” series – said there were plans to revive the live-action “Tick” series with Patrick Warburton. But that was then.
Warburton is now starring on the NBC sitcom “Crowded,” and Amazon is hiring a new Tick for its new “Tick” pilot.
For some reason Warburton is nonetheless expected to serve as executive producer on Amazon's new "Tick."

New actors have already been hired to play sidekick Arthur and his sister Dot. No word yet on who, if anyone, will step in the boots of Liz Vassey and Nestor Carbonell, who played Captain Liberty and Batmanuel.
Only nine episodes of “The Tick” ran on Fox in 2001, all of them brilliant.
